OverviewThe author draws from his practical experience as a lawyer for over 33 years to compile a helpful list of topics of interest to the average layperson who has little or no legal expertise or background. The focus is to assist those involved with the legal process and face legal issues on how to manage their legal situations in an effective and least disruptive way. The practical tips offered in this book are the culmination of many years of trial and error and come with the realization that the law keeps evolving, but human nature remains static. In this book, you will learn: How to become a better witness How judges think How to be an effective self-represented litigant How to make a good impression at court How to avoid traps associated with legal situations How to negotiate your legal issues effectively What to do not to lose your case How to manage stress in legal situations How to deal with the media Plus, you are given 130 tips as a bonus on how to better manage your legal affairs.
